Kinky, my Therfield Heath circuit is at http://www.fetcheveryone.com/routes-view.php?id=260318 a mixture of grass, trail, slope down through some woods, edge of farm fields, past a defunct firing range, chalk hills over the golf course. Starts and finishes at the heath pavilion. I'm hoping to go there for a hill training run soon if you want to meet up for me to show you the route, perhaps once in each direction. Also, Royston Runners are organising the Harvest Trail HM at Therfield Heath on Sunday 21st September, and although their route isn't being published, I suspect that some of it uses my circuit. Flanker, possibly those are the hills which can be seen from the A10. I'm familiar with the "hills" around Haslingfield due to my cycling, but I don't know about off road paths. The road between Barrington and Haslingfield goes over a nice steep (well, steep for round here ;-)) hill, and isn't too busy. I've seen signs for footpaths, but I've never used them. |
